AI Agent from Fetch.ai Grants Natural Language Access to Over 30 Ethereum Virtual Machine Chains
In a significant stride towards democratizing blockchain access, Fetch.ai introduced its latest AI agent, uagent-evm-mcp, on the 27th of May. This innovative tool enables straightforward interaction with over 30 EVM-compatible blockchains using easy-to-understand English prompts. The cornerstone of this agent lies in its natural language processing capabilities, aiming to simplify access to intricate blockchain data.
Users can now execute requests such as balances inquiry, token details, transaction records, or contract events using straightforward queries. The need for mastering specific Web3 interfaces or blockchain protocols is rendered obsolete, resulting in a broadened user base.
The new AI agent serves as a bridge between AI models and numerous blockchain networks, obscuring technical information behind a unified interface across multiple EVM networks. Compatible networks encompass Ethereum, Polygon, Arbitrum, Avalanche, and many others. Developers can query balances, metadata, and transactions without immersing themselves in low-level blockchain coding. Smart contract events and NFT ownership checks are now accessible through simple user prompts. The tool converts English questions like "What is the ETH balance?" into coherent queries. Responses are delivered in structured formats matching blockchain context specifications for both developers and users.
Communication within the agent is facilitated by the Model Context Protocol (MCP)—a protocol ensuring compatibility across various networks without laborious manual RPC or SDK setup. Developers can at their disposal retrieve block details, transaction receipts, and contract information effortlessly. The MCP allows agents to keep tabs on smart contract events or estimate gas fees with ease. Implementing this layer expedites the development time for blockchain-related application construction. Users additionally experience benefits from straightforward query flows while developers evade complicated configuration tasks.
The AI agent leverages Fetch.ai's ASI:One platform, an underlying framework for running intelligent blockchain agents. This platform employs a multi-step reasoning design to make logical decisions autonomously. ASI:One integrates seamlessly with external APIs and tools, empowering agents to function based on plain language instructions. They can fetch data, monitor events, or trigger contract functions according to user demands. This methodology transforms complex blockchain operations into user-friendly actions. Developers profit from swift setup and a consistent interface across multiple blockchain systems.
